Learn more about Montalcino

Medieval stone walls surround this hilltop town where Brunello wine tastings await in historic cellars beneath the fortress. Climb the Torre del Palazzo Comunale for valley views, then sample local pecorino cheese and honey at shops along the narrow lanes.

Best time to go to Montalcino

The best time to visit Montalcino is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Montalcino

To reach Montalcino, you can fly into several major airports. Rome's Fiumicino Airport (FCO) is approximately 152.9km away, with nearby hotels such as the 5-star QC Grand Hotel Roma, 3.2km from the airport, and the Hilton Garden Inn Rome Airport, just 1.6km away. Florence's Peretola Airport (FLR) is about 86.9km distant, offering luxury stays like the 5-star Bernini Palace, 6.4km from the airport. Finally, Pisa's Galileo Galilei Airport (PSA) is 112.7km from Montalcino, with excellent options like the 5-star Bagni di Pisa Palace & Thermal Spa, 8.0km away, ensuring convenient access for travellers.

What is the best area to stay in Montalcino?
The best area to stay in Montalcino is within the historic walls of the town itself, particularly around the central Piazza del Popolo.

This charming hilltop town is small and easily explored on foot, with its narrow, winding streets leading to various shops, restaurants, and wine bars. The Fortezza di Montalcino, a medieval fortress, dominates the skyline and offers panoramic views of the surrounding Val d'Orcia. Staying within the walls provides immediate access to the town's character and amenities.

Couples often find Montalcino town ideal for a romantic getaway. They can enjoy leisurely strolls, discover hidden courtyards, and savour exquisite local cuisine and Brunello wine without needing to drive. Many hotels and guesthouses within the walls offer a traditional Tuscan experience, sometimes with views overlooking the rolling hills.

For those seeking a more secluded and expansive experience, particularly families or groups who appreciate privacy and space, staying in an agriturismo or villa just outside the town offers a wonderful alternative. These properties are typically set amongst vineyards or olive groves, providing a tranquil base with amenities like private pools and gardens.

When is the best time to go to Montalcino?
The best time to visit Montalcino is during the sp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October) months.

During these periods, the weather is pleasantly mild, making it ideal for exploring the town on foot and enjoying the scenic Tuscan countryside. Spring brings blooming wildflowers and lush green vineyards, while autumn offers the rich colours of the harvest season and truffle hunting opportunities. Both seasons also see fewer crowds compared to the peak summer months, allowing for a more relaxed experience.

For couples looking for a romantic escape, these shoulder seasons provide superb conditions for wine-tasting tours at local vineyards, leisurely walks through the rolling hills, and enjoying al fresco dining with stunning views. The cooler temperatures are also conducive to exploring Montalcino's historic fortress and its charming cobbled streets without feeling too warm.

Travellers interested in culinary experiences will find autumn particularly appealing, as it coincides with grape harvesting and olive pressing.
